Appendix A. Advanced and Admin System Settings

Tap "In charger" and select one or several of the check boxes "Show device info", "Mute" and
"End Call" to change what information to show and handset behavior when the handset is
placed in the rack charger.
Select the "Power button ends call" check box to enable the power button to be used for
ending calls.
NOTE: Not all system settings are available in the default Settings view. To access additional
system settings tap "Admin settings", then enter the administration code and click OK
(see for information about the additional system settings). For normal use, it is
recommended to use the default system settings set by your system administrator.
